Hola buenas noches hoy vengo haciendo una pregunta de codigo :)
Bueno el codigo de abajo es el codigo de registrar datos en una BD algo sencillo pero yo me e preguntado esta bien ?es que yo e visto otros tipo de codigos,mas pequeños a estos y me e preguntado si esta bien que use este tipo de codigo o que deberia mejor :)
ESPERO Y ALGUIEN ME CONTESTE :)
-------------------------Este codigo fue unos de los primero pero el que siempre e usado------------------
Connection reg = conexionConBaseDatos.getConexion();
String sql = "INSERT INTO faltas(codigo,profesor,hr,clase,dia,motivo)VALUES(?,?,?,?,?,?)";
try{
PreparedStatement pst= reg.prepareStatement(sql);
pst.setString(1, txtcodigo.getText());
pst.setString(2, txtprofesor.getText());
pst.setString(3, txthrfaltada.getText());
pst.setString(4, txtclasefaltada.getText());
pst.setString(5,txtdiafaltada.getText());
pst.setString(6, txtmotivo.getText());
int n = pst.executeUpdate();
if (n>0){
JOptionPane.showMessageDialog(null,"FALTA REGISTRADA");
}
}catch (Exception e){
JOptionPane.showMessageDialog(null,"DISCULPE LA FALTA NO A SIDO REGISTRADA/INGRESE LOS DATOS NUEVAMENTE");
}
}